This is what he said.
What everybody said is right. I noticed nothing when I put on the new manifold. This may be because of several reasons. I noticed some BIG gains when I put my gears in. It brought everything else alive it seemed like. The bad part is that I did the manifold and the gears at the same time. I can't tell now. The other thing is that the car was never timed after the manifold was put in. I may be retarding my timingand not knowing it. Plus I am still running stock plug gap. If I timed it, put in plugs with the proper gap, and put in a posi unit I bet I could drop my times from 9.4- 9.5 to 9.2-9.3 (The track I race on every week is only an 1/8 mile track...I am currently FIRST in the points battle however!) My aren't coated. I wish I would have but I had a hard enough time getting them in as it is. How the hell did you get yours to drop in There????? Let me know about your troubles and trials too. maybe I would learn from you. I would realy like to know about your TBI spacer. Did it help in times any? Pull harder? How did you bend the fuel lines to get them to go on right? THe manifold is 1/4 inch higher than the stock one and I had the hardest time just butting the fuel lines back on!
